The primary interest in cat litter throughout pregnancy depends on its association with toxoplasmosis, a parasitic infection caused by the Toxoplasma gondii parasite. Cats, especially those who invest time outdoors, can become infected with this parasite by searching and consuming contaminated victim or by coming into contact with polluted soil. As soon as infected, cats can shed the parasite in their feces for a short duration, normally one to 2 weeks, which is when they become carriers of the disease.
Toxoplasmosis itself may not trigger any signs in healthy people, but it can have extreme effects for pregnant females and their coming babies if contracted during pregnancy. The parasite can be transmitted to humans through accidental consumption of polluted cat feces, soil, or undercooked meat including the parasite's cysts. In pregnant ladies, toxoplasmosis can result in miscarriage, stillbirth, or genetic specials needs in the child, such as hearing loss, vision problems, or intellectual specials needs.
Offered the possible threats related to toxoplasmosis, pregnant ladies are frequently recommended to take safety measures when dealing with cat litter. Here are some important steps to reduce the risk of infection:
If possible, ask a partner, family member, or good friend to take control of the job of cleaning up the litter box during pregnancy. This reduces direct exposure to cat feces, decreasing the threat of infection.
If you should clean the litter box yourself, wear non reusable gloves and a mask to avoid direct contact with the feces and inhalation of air-borne particles.
Ensure the litter box is cleaned daily. The Toxoplasma gondii parasite needs a duration of one to five days to become transmittable after being shed in feline feces. Prompt elimination of feces decreases the possibility of transmission.
After dealing with cat litter or cleaning the litter box, clean your hands completely with soap and water to remove any potential contamination.
Avoid gardening or dealing with soil, especially without gloves, as it might include Toxoplasma gondii cysts from cat feces.
To lower the threat of contracting toxoplasmosis from food, guarantee all meat is cooked completely to kill any parasites present.
